Warning Signs You Need Foundation Leak Water Damage Restoration
Foundation leaks can be sneaky, but there are some telltale signs that show you need our help.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ger headaches down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of a foundation leak. Don’t ignore the smell, it’s a sign of a bigger problem.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s a sign that water is seeping into your property. Don’t wait, call us today to schedule an inspection.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it could be a sign of a foundation leak. Don’t ignore the damage, it’ll only get worse.
Increased Water Bills
If your water bills are suddenly increasing, it could be a sign that water is leaking somewhere in your property. Don’t ignore the increase, it’s a sign of a bigger problem.
Foundation Cracks or Shifts
If you notice foundation cracks or shifts, it could be a sign of a foundation leak. Don’t ignore the cracks, they’ll only get worse.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
If you notice unusual noises or sounds coming from your walls or floors, it could be a sign of a foundation leak. Don’t ignore the sounds, they’re a sign of a bigger problem.

Foundation Leak Water Damage Restoration Cost in Stillwater, MN
The cost of foundation leak water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Stillwater, MN.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Leak detection and repair | $500 – $2,500 | Size and complexity of the leak, materials used |
| Water extraction and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water extracted, equipment used |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size and scope of the restoration, materials used |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of the job, equipment used |
